What is being bought
Contactless Bankcard Middle and Back Office (CBMBO) agreement with respect to the implementation, operation and maintenance of Middle Office and Back Office services that shall enable contactless bankcard transaction processing compliant with bank card scheme Transit rules and token agnostic account based ticketing (including ITSO tokens).

- Lot 1 · #1Individual lot title not publishedactivePublished valueNot publishedTransport for Greater Manchester (“TfGM”) now wish to procure a Contactless Bankcard Middle and Back Office (CBMBO) Service Agreement(“Agreement”) which shall enable the Implementation, operation and maintenance of a Middle Office Service and Back Office Service Option that will support delivery of TfGM’s Ticketing Schemes. Given that over the term of the Agreement, Ticketing Schemes will be subject to frequent revision and development, re-configuration and extension of both the Middle Office Service and Back Office Service (Option) may be required to a number of additional transport and associated modes (in addition to those modes that are currently within scope of existing TfGM Ticketing Schemes). Consequently, the Middle Office Service and Back Office Service (Option) may be deployed on (but not limited to) Tram, Light Rail, Bus, Heavy Rail, Taxi, Car-Club, Car-Hire, Parking and Park and Ride, Micro mobility, Active Travel and other travel modes. Additionally, the Place of Performance that is set out in section II.2.3 of this notice reflects a longer-term ambition of TfGM to extend Ticketing Schemes to areas that are adjacent to Greater Manchester (UKD-North West England, UKE Yorkshire and the Humber, UKF-East Midlands. UKG-West Midlands, UKL-Wales) and may or may not apply to the Agreement during the term. The Supplier shall provide a Middle Office Service that shall: - Integrate to Validators, Electronic Ticketing Machines, Gatelines, Revenue Inspection Devices, Retail Devices, other related Field Equipment Devices and other equipment that is capable of proving a Token ID such as (but not limited to Mobile Phones, Wearable Devices, ANPR Infrastructure; ITSO media, Smart-Cards, Barcodes, Magnetic Stripe Cards and biometric reading devices, as may be required to enable TfGM’s Ticketing Schemes. The estate of such infrastructure may be supplied, installed, commissioned, operated and maintained by an assortment of vendors and suppliers; - Provide an encryption key that will be installed on each Platform Validator, Electronic Ticketing Machine and other Field Equipment Device that will ensure that all bankcard holder data that has been captured at these devices may be securely transferred to the Middle Office service for decryption; - Tokenise customer bankcard information such that tokenised data may be consumed in the Back Office Service (Option) in relation to the application of business rules that determine product pricing; - Process contactless bankcard data compliant with Payment Card Industries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) v 4.0.1; - Install and Commission (and if directed de-commission) Middle Offices and their supporting systems including any necessary connection to TfGM networks, civil works and testing; and - Operate and maintain the deployed estate of Middle Office infrastructure to comply with the required standards; The Supplier shall provide a Back Office Service (Option) that shall: - apply business rules that are required to apply pricing in respect of TfGM’s Ticketing Schemes; - apply the business rules that are required to enable TfGM’s contactless bankcard Pay as you Go (PAYG) Ticketing Scheme compliant with card scheme (Visa and Mastercard) Transit Model 2 scheme rules, and potentially enable the extension of TfGM’s contactless bankcard PAYG Ticketing Scheme to additional bank card schemes; - Under an option to implement Account Based Ticketing, apply token-agnostic business rules in relation to TfGM’s Ticketing Schemes for Account Based Ticketing products; - read ITSO media (for both digital and physical media compliant with the latest ITSO 2.1.5 standard) and ITSO Tokens; - (as an Option) read two-dimensional Barcodes; and - enable Account Based Ticketing products through the use of token agnostic identification; Additionally, the Contactless Bankcard Middle and Back Office (CBMBO) Service Agreement will require Implementation Services to implement, test and deploy both the Middle Office Service and Back Office Service to operation, following which an Operational Service will be provided. Potential Supplier Solutions will work in conjunction with a Platform Validator and Field Equipment Service, Electronic Ticketing Machine (ETM) Service, Merchant Acquirer and Payment Gateway Service and ITSO Contract Service that will be appointed by TfGM.
